"Pair Of Ceremonial Armchairs, Faces With Hoods, Haute Epoque Style, Renaissance, 19th Century"
Imposing pair of molded and carved walnut state armchairs in the Haute Epoque / Renaissance style, made in the mid-19th century. Magnificently carved, our armchairs have a very interesting and rare decoration on the armrests representing the faces of hooded men with a somewhat mocking expression. The base of our seats is worked in sheep bone, all covered with very fine acanthus leaves present including on the rear legs. This motif is repeated on the armrests. Both wide and deep, these armchairs are very well padded and extremely comfortable. They are covered with a cream-colored fabric decorated with sheaves of wheat and wreaths of flowers. The woodwork is in perfect condition and very healthy. The structure is very stable. Upholstery and fabric are recent, the fabrics have tiny little marks without the slightest impact.
